Q: QuestionDo the feet come off of this to make it a little shorter than the 71 7/8 height?
Asked by Anonymous.
- A:Answer Short answer - no. There are no extended feet. Under the front, there's a foot on each side that can screw down to level it in place. But, when screwed all the way in, they tuck up inside the frame and only the rollers are touching the floor. You can't remove them, but even if you did you'd only gain a fraction of an inch and have a scratch frame sliding on the floor.

Q: QuestionDoes the ice box trays for cubed ice and small bites have a sensor to stop making ice when full ? Or do you have to shut off yourself ?
Asked by Robert.
- A:Answer It shuts off on its own. It will begin again when the ice gets low.
